数据库课程设计报告

发布 2022-10-04 11:31:28 阅读 6494

山西大同大学煤炭工程学院。

数据库课程设计总结报告。

设计题目:病人入院管理系统。

学生姓名:刘海龙。

系别:采矿系。

专业:测绘工程。

班级:09测绘一班。

学号:0908***

指导教师:韩亮

2023年 1 月 10 日。

题目 access病人入院管理系统

专业、班级09测绘一班。

学号 0908姓名刘海龙

主要内容:利用access2003进行医院病人信息管理系统设计,实现病人基本信息查询,**基本信息查询,病人护理专业**查询,病人入出院信息查询及打印信息表。

基本要求:设计的数据库系统主要包含以下内容:

1)access表的创建 (2)access查询的创建

3)access窗体的创建及设计(4)access病人入出院报表的创建等。

主要参考资料等:

1] 文东 access 2003 数据库应用 . 北京: 科学出版社, 2010.

2] 张宇 access数据库应用技术 . 北京:中国铁道出版社,2006.

完成期限:2013/01/11

指导教师签名。

2013 年月日。

目录。课程设计任务书 2

目录 3一、 需求分析 4

二、 系统功能分析 4

三、 e-r图 5

四、 数据库设计 8

五、 详细设计 11

六、 运行效果 15

七、 总结与体会 19

八、 参考文献 20

一、 需求分析。

根据人们对医疗服务的规模日益扩增,病人入院手续简化的改革,病人与**的日常管理的细化,特别是随着社会城镇化的逐渐深入,面对诸多问题时:一款优秀的病人入院管理系统是每一个现代化医院管理的必备的工具。病人入院管理系统是一个庞大的体系,传统方式的病人管理将会造成巨大的人力和物力的浪费 ,同时还会造成病人入院难,**难,**护理病人不明确的问题,还会加重医患关系紧张的问题。

同时本系统的设计可以使工作人员实现计算机管理,减轻工作量,实现病人入院管理的高效化。

功能需求:系统管理员可以通过该应用程序对病人全部信息进行管理;

病人和系统管理员可以通过应用程序查询**的全部信息;

病人可以通过应用程序查询自己的入院登记情况;

系统管理员可以通过应用程序对**信息进行管理;

**可以通过应用程序对病人进行管理;

病人和**的信息可以在医院的信息点进行深入了解以实现彼此的透明化管理;

二、 系统功能分析。

根据需求分析,给出模块图。

三、 e-r图。

1)用户er图:

2)图书er图:

综合er图。

病人入院管理er图。

四、 数据库设计。

用户表(用户id号,登录名,地址,密码,**,电子邮件,注册时间),主码为id号,符合三范式。

图书表(图书id,书名,图书类别,作者,出版社,**,销售**,内容和目录,图书简介,入库时间),主码为图书id,符合三范式。

图书分类信息表(图书分类id,图书分类名称)主码为图书分类id,符合三范式。

订单基本信息表(订单id,提交时间,总金额,用户id,订单备注,是否发货,是否付款)主码为订单id,符合三范式。

订单详细信息表(唯一编号,订单id,图书id,数量)主码为唯一编号,符合三范式。

表4-1 用户表(user)

表4-2 图书表(book)

表4-3 图书分类信息表(bookcategory)

表4-4 订单详细信息表(orderinfo)

表4-5 订单基本信息表(order)

五、 详细设计。

部分设计**如下:

/ 图书出版管理系统 : implementation of the cmyview class

#include ""

#include "图书出版管理系统。h"

/开始声明。

#include ""

#include ""

/结束声明。

#include "图书出版管理系统"

#include "图书出版管理系统"

#include "图书出版管理系统"

#ifdef _debug

#define new debug_new

#undef this_file

static char this_file file__;

#endif

cmyview::cmyview()

: crecordview(cmyview::idd)

//}afx_data_init

// todo: add construction code here

cmyview::~cmyview()

/ cmyview message handlers

/增加记录按钮**。

void cmyview::onbuttonaddnew()

// todo: add your control notification handler code here

m_pset->addnew();

updatedata(false);

/删除记录按钮**。

void cmyview::onbuttondeldte()

// todo: add your control notification handler code here

m_pset->delete();

m_pset->movenext();

if(m_pset->iseof())

m_pset->movelast();

if(m_pset->isbof())

m_pset->setfieldnull(null);

updatedata(false);

/刷新按钮**。

void cmyview::onbuttonupdate()

// todo: add your control notification handler code here

updatedata();

m_pset->update();

m_pset->requery();

// m_pset->cancelupdate();

/第一条按钮**。

void cmyview::onbuttonfirst()

// todo: add your control notification handler code here

m_pset->movefirst();

if(m_pset->isbof())

messagebox("记录已经在第一条");

m_pset->movenext();

updatedata(false);

return;

数据库课程设计报告

jia服装销售系统。指导老师 索剑。系名 计算机科学系。学号 111405128 姓名 薛文科 班级 11计算机1班。目录。第一章绪论3 1.1课题简介3 1.2设计目的3 1.3设计内容3 1.4系统实验要求3 第二章需求分析3 2.1系统基本功能3 2.2权限划分4 2.3系统运作流程4 2.4...

数据库课程设计报告

课程设计。数据库课程设计任务书 3 图书管理系统说明书 5 一 系统说明 5 二 系统功能 5 三 系统结构流程图 菜单调用关系 6 四 数据表结构 7 五 图书管理数据库相关信息 8 七 课程设计总结 11 本科 一 设计目的。通过课程设计使学生进一步掌握用sql开发小型应用程序的过程和方法,掌握...

数据库课程设计报告

大连科技学院。2011年 12月 04 日。目录。1 前言页码。1.1 问题提出页码。1.2 意义页码。2 系统需求分析页码。2.1 系统功能分析页码。2.2 系统功能模块设计页码。3 数据库的概念结构设计页码。3.1数据抽象页码。3.2设计全局概念模式页码。4 数据库的逻辑设计页码。4.1形成初始...